Franklin Food Pantry closed to clients during the Labor Day week
"The Pantry is closed to clients Monday, September 2, 2024, and will reopen on September 10, 2024.
Closed weeks allow The Pantry to deep clean the shopping area, host group workshops, meet and collaborate with partner agencies, stock up on inventory, and more.
We make sure to remind our clients of additional food resources that are available to them during our closed week. Thank you!"

Franklin Residents: Closure of Municipal Buildings 2/25/2022
Closure of Municipal Buildings 2/25/2022
Dear Franklin Constituents,
All town administrative offices and buildings will be closed today, Friday, February 25th, 2022 due to inclement weather.
The Police Department has declared a town wide parking ban in effect 2/25/2022 from 1am through 8pm.
All non-emergency personnel will continue to be available for remote work through our regular department business hours of 8am-1pm. Staff will still be available via phone, email and other networks to conduct business. Please call for service and a staff member will get back to you.
